Transaction 1271430924e6b32b60ee69797f8b81c82830d41f94d0884a502655f5739e60fa

1 Input
2 Outputs
  • 1271430924e6b32b60ee69797f8b81c82830d41f94d0884a502655f5739e60fa:0
  • value  88700
    address  166PsdsH6vT3gDuCn9V2ZDV7FsJzLJEMm5
  • 1271430924e6b32b60ee69797f8b81c82830d41f94d0884a502655f5739e60fa:1
  • value  17700000
    address  1HdRh1dn3HYnEnJR2cqqhfMDzErsfdNKui